Walter & Emily is an American sitcom that aired on NBC from November 16, 1991 to February 22, 1992.[1] The series was created by Paul Perlove, and produced by Witt/Thomas Productions in association with Touchstone Television.

Plot

Retired salesman Walter Collins' divorced son Matt, a sportswriter, had custody of his 11-year-old son Zach on the condition that the boys grandparents (Walter and Emily) would also be around to help raise him.
